发明名称 电脑程式除错系统及方法
摘要 一种程式除错方法,该方法包括步骤:(a)将旗标暂存器的追踪旗标设置为“1”;(b)将暂存器压入堆叠;(c)读取下一个指令的操作码并判断指令的类型;(d)若为POPF指令,将要储存的追踪旗标设置为“1”,转到步骤(g);(e)若为控制转移指令且满足转移条件,则计算转移的起始位址及目的位址,否则直接转到步骤(g);(f)储存起始位址及目的位址;及(g)将压入堆叠的暂存器弹出堆叠并返回原程式。本发明还提供一种程式除错系统。本发明能够在系统模式下追踪程式的执行过程。
申请公布号 TW200933360 申请公布日期 2009.08.01
申请号 TW097101906 申请日期 2008.01.18
申请人 鸿海精密工业股份有限公司 发明人 赖庆育
分类号 G06F11/36(2006.01) 主分类号 G06F11/36(2006.01)
代理机构 代理人
主权项
地址 台北县土城市自由街2号